nexar-rdma

RDMA and GPUDirect transport extensions for nexar.

Provides InfiniBand/RoCE kernel-bypass transport as a drop-in extension to nexar's QUIC-based communication. After bootstrapping a nexar cluster, establish an RDMA mesh over the existing connections for zero-copy, OS-bypass data transfers.

Features

Feature What it enables Extra dependencies
(default) RDMA transport via ibverbs (InfiniBand/RoCE) libibverbs (rdma-core)
gpudirect GPU memory ↔ NIC directly, CudaAdapter libibverbs + CUDA runtime

Usage

[dependencies]
nexar-rdma = "<use-latest-version>"

# For GPUDirect:
# nexar-rdma = { version = "<use-latest-version>", features = ["gpudirect"] }
use nexar_rdma::{bootstrap::establish_rdma_mesh, PeerConnectionRdmaExt};

// After nexar bootstrap, layer RDMA on top:
establish_rdma_mesh(&clients).await;

With the gpudirect feature, CudaAdapter implements nexar's DeviceAdapter trait for GPU memory, and NexarClientRdmaExt adds RDMA-accelerated collective operations.

Building

# RDMA (requires libibverbs / rdma-core)
cargo build -p nexar-rdma --release

# GPUDirect RDMA (requires libibverbs + CUDA)
cargo build -p nexar-rdma --release --features gpudirect
